Sidney Strickland · New York, New York
Dr. Sidney Strickland's lab at Rockefeller University focuses on understanding the mechanisms of Alzheimer's disease (AD), particularly the roles of inflammation and blood clotting. They investigate how interactions between the beta-amyloid peptide and fibrinogen contribute to cognitive decline and vascular dysfunction in AD. The lab aims to develop new therapeutic strategies by targeting these molecular interactions and understanding their impact on brain health.
